Judgment Misguided: Intuition and Error in Public Decision Making
Baron, Jonathan (Professor of Psychology, Professor of Psychology, University of Pennsylvania, USA)
Baron argues that our well-meant and deeply felt intuitions about what is right often prevent us from achieving the results we want. Rather than banishing these intuitions, he suggests that they should take a secondary role, and that we base our decisions affecting the common good on an understanding of consequences, results, and effects.
